Ingredients of Roasted Mushrooms and Asparagus
- Prepare 1 bunch of asparagus, trimmed.
- It's 1/2 of # mushrooms, quartered.
- It's 2 sprigs of rosemary, minced.
- You need 4 sprigs of thyme, minced.
- You need 1/2 tsp of garlic powder.
- You need 2 tsp of olive oil.
- Prepare to taste of S&P.
- It's 2 tsp of butter, cut into small chunks.

Roasted Mushrooms and Asparagus instructions
- Preheat oven to 450°. Spray a baking sheet with cooking spray. Put the mushrooms and asparagus in a bowl and drizzle with olive oil. Season with the spices. Stir to coat it all. Lay mixture on baking sheet evenly. Put butter chunks scattered over the mixture. Roast for 10 minutes, check to make sure asparagus is tender. If not, then roast 2 more minutes. Be careful not to overcook the asparagus..
